Is your workspace a nightmare of clutter? You're not alone! A disorganized desk can lead to decreased productivity and heightened stress levels. To turn chaos into clarity, consider starting with these 10 tips for organizing your desk. First, clear everything off your desk and wipe it down to create a fresh start. Next, integrate storage solutions that promote an organized environment. Use drawer dividers, desk organizers, or even wall-mounted shelves to keep everything in its place. Remember, it’s vital to keep only what you need within arm's reach. Items that don’t see regular use can be stored away. Another tip is to implement a 'one-in, one-out' rule: every time you bring a new item to your desk, remove an old one. This practice will maintain your tidy workspace over time. Lastly, make it a habit to declutter your desk at the end of each day—spend just five minutes putting things away to enjoy a clean slate in the morning. Creating a productive workspace goes beyond choosing the right furniture; it involves understanding the psychology behind desk organization. A cluttered desk can lead to distractions and decreased efficiency, while a well-organized workspace can foster focus and creativity. To begin, declutter your desk by removing items that are not essential to your daily tasks. Consider using a desk organizer or storage solutions that encourage minimalism. Research shows that the way we organize our workspace can significantly affect our mental state, so setting up a designated spot for everything can help you achieve a sense of order and calm.
Additionally, implementing color psychology can enhance your productive workspace. Colors like blue promote calmness and concentration, while yellow stimulates creativity. When arranging your desk, think about adding touches of these colors through your stationery, wall art, or even your chair. Remember, the layout of your workspace also impacts your cognitive function; consider a layout that allows for easy movement and access to necessary tools.
